if it's a diesel and the smoke is blue, i'd look at the breather on top of the head, and the return line from the turbo to the sump. i've recently had a problem with the engine being pressurised because of a blocked breather, causing smoke intermittently at odd times. remember that the engine "torques" the opposite way in reverse, this could be sloshing oil about somewhere.

if the smoke is black, that would mean excess fuel- possible wear in the injection pump?

and remember that we tend to (or i do anyway) stand on the throttle a bit more in reverse- this will show up oil burning through the turbo and valve stem seals, and coking of the intake manifold more readily than blipping the throttle.
